互联网信息服务器性能:负载均衡与服务器集群
在互联网信息服务器(IIS)达到最大服务请求容量,且各子系统性能已被充分挖掘后,可通过使用多台物理机器支持单个逻辑Web服务器来提升性能,同时增强容错能力。以下介绍三种实现方式。
1. 轮询域名系统(DNS)负载分配
DNS服务器是一个分层分布式数据库,可实现主机名到IP地址的正反映射。当IIS服务器安装配置后,会向DNS服务器添加A和PTR记录,以便域名主服务器根据主机名解析IIS服务器的IP地址。通常会使用CNAME记录为Web服务器添加别名,如 www.oreilly.com 是 helio.ora.com 的别名。
若要添加多台物理主机支持Web服务器,只需在这些机器上复制内容,并将 www 主机名设为所有物理服务器主机名的别名。例如, srvr1.company.com 、 srvr2.company.com 和 srvr3.company.com 都支持 www.company.com ,则 www.company.com 应是这三个主机名的别名。
当客户端请求解析 www.company.com 的主机名时,DNS服务器会返回所有三个IP地址的列表,客户端将请求发送到列表中的第一个IP地址。下次查询时,DNS服务器会以轮询方式改变列表顺序,使第二个请求发送到不同的服务器。
以下是使用 nslookup <
超级会员免费看
订阅专栏 解锁全文
2452

被折叠的 条评论
为什么被折叠?



